PA equipment types
Microphone types
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_microphone_362x125_baf25c19a1fd27926e0e6429b76459bb.jpg)
Microphone types
A microphones is a device that converts sound into electrical signals. There are many types of microphone available for lots of different applications.
Cable types
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_cable_362x125_f678f121a3d0a607183654175034aa79.jpg)
Cable types
A variety of cables and connector types are used to transmit signals for different equipment and applications.
Mixer types
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_mixer_362x125_18f8965b0448669c795019d978c2cb39.jpg)
Mixer types
There are several different types of mixer, including analog mixers, digital mixers, and powered mixers.
Power amplifier types
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_amplifier_362x125_0abf83bf68014657bae83cba2a3fb0b1.jpg)
Power amplifier types
There are a variety of power amplifiers, including stand-alone power amplifiers , powered speakers, and powered mixers.
Speaker types
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_speaker_362x125_7f9e2b010c71805898ab8f1eb9de1d58.jpg)
Speaker types
There are many different kinds of speaker, both passive speakers and self-powered speakers.
Sound Shaping: Effects
What is reverberation?
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_reverb_362x125_8c0a0bff87e412ff4bd83ffc32e9082c.jpg)
What is reverberation?
Reverberation is an effect that brings out the depth and width of sound by adding numerous subtle echoes.
What are compressors?
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_compressor_362x125_140b22474fc7351dc48ae75fab37ac68.jpg)
What are compressors?
Compressors are effects that narrow the dynamic range (the difference between loud and quiet sounds) by compressing sound.
What are equalizers?
![](/fr/files/pa_beginners_top_menu_equlizer_362x125_b3d40e4215c6cc592546c4522692d17b.jpg)
What are equalizers?
Equalizers are effects that adjust tone by boosting and attenuating specific frequencies.
